## Onboarding: Ledgerline FX

When reviewing conversion code, check that all amounts use scaled integers, never floats; rounding must be banker's rounding at the final step only. Intermediate truncation has caused drift in the Corvane ledger before. Release builds are verified against the team's signing key, which is provided below.

deploy key for bawig-tajop: bky9_PQ3GVoQw1

We reviewed the flaky integration tests in the PayBridge settlement suite. New team members should know these tests depend on the sandbox clearing simulator, which resets nightly; runs overlapping the reset window fail intermittently. Agreed actions: pin test runs outside the reset window, add a readiness probe before the suite starts, and quarantine the three worst offenders. A tracking epic will be filed this week. Ownership of the stabilization work goes to the engineer named below.

account owner for kagef-kahag: Norwyn Quenmir Ulaax

## Onboarding: The Sievegate Layer

Before any read hits our key-value store, Pantrykeep, it passes through Sievegate — a bloom filter that screens out lookups for keys that definitely don't exist. This cuts backend load by roughly half during traffic spikes. The filter is rebuilt nightly from a snapshot, so expect brief false-positive drift after restarts. To query Sievegate's admin endpoint locally, use the internal key below.

gateway credential: kto7_GoY89Me